About this ebook

The Garden of Eden isn't actually real... is it?


Mycah doesn't think so, but he's never given it much thought. He's never had reason to. Not until his plan to rob the mighty Stormqueen goes horribly wrong...


Now Mycah's life hangs in the balance, and all the Stormqueen wants is a simple favor: for Mycah to travel to the Garden of Eden and steal a tablet of power from God himself.


Could the Garden truly exist? And if so, what lies there? Mycah's about to discover the shocking truth...
